Transaction 3990c31c878f3c5b3614e36bac78405561c4efae271f2855b0c88a5d6ef532ba

1 Input
2 Outputs
  • 3990c31c878f3c5b3614e36bac78405561c4efae271f2855b0c88a5d6ef532ba:0
  • value  1051208
    address  1BP5mEuhyd2BEKXJ6JKcd75iaANNcqscTU
  • 3990c31c878f3c5b3614e36bac78405561c4efae271f2855b0c88a5d6ef532ba:1
  • value  6377774
    address  1NE2zNKKA1ZF4DWQytSw3avg4mtURMevw3